ABOUT FAIRHUUR

The Fairhuur Foundation is a student initiative that assists tenants and landlords with a wide range of rental issues. We provide accessible and affordable legal advice, offer practical solutions, and, when necessary, work on a results-oriented basis according to a no cure, no pay model. Without any commercial interest, we use our knowledge and experience to make a difference — ensuring that no one has to face these issues alone.

 

The Fairhuur Foundation helps tenants and landlords prevent and resolve problems related to tenancy law. Our core belief is that clear agreements, transparency, and proper guidance contribute to a fair and balanced rental market in which both parties feel respected and protected.

 

We do this by providing independent and expert legal advice. This may concern tenancy agreements, rent levels, or maintenance obligations, but also other practical issues that may arise. When necessary, we assist tenants and landlords in formal proceedings — for example, before the Rent Tribunal. In this way, even disputes where the parties initially seem far apart can often be brought to a satisfactory resolution.

 

In addition, we work to promote greater stability, trust, and quality in the rental market. We award certifications that stand for openness, reliability, and well-defined agreements, thereby contributing to positive and sustainable relationships between tenants and landlords.
